Question
A sinlge phase load consist of a coil having a resistance of 10 Ω and an inductance of 100 mH. The coil is connected to a 150 V, 50Hz AC supply. Determine:
(i) the impedance of the coil ;
(ii) the current drawn by the coil;
(iii) the apparent power;
(iv) the active ower;
(v) the reactive power;
(vi) the power factor.
(vii) also draw the power triangle and label all the values.
